Yes — Made in USA
Mountain House manufactures its products in the United States — specifically in Albany, OR. Our verification team confirmed this through public manufacturing claims, factory records, and product listings.

Heritage and History
Mountain House is a product line of Oregon Freeze Dry, which was founded in Albany, Oregon in 1963 and became the world's leading contract freeze-dryer of food. Oregon Freeze Dry initially served the space program and military before developing the Mountain House consumer line in 1968 for backpackers who needed lightweight, nutritious food that required no refrigeration.
Freeze-drying is a technical process that removes moisture from food while preserving cellular structure, flavor, and nutritional content. The result is food that rehydrates almost perfectly, tasting nearly identical to the original cooked meal — a remarkable achievement that has made Mountain House the dominant brand in freeze-dried food for over five decades.
Made in Albany, Oregon
Every Mountain House meal is freeze-dried at Oregon Freeze Dry's Albany, Oregon facility, where the process involves cooking the food, rapidly freezing it, and then removing moisture in a vacuum chamber at low temperatures. The entire freeze-drying process is conducted on-site, from food preparation through packaging.
The 30-year shelf life that Mountain House claims is not marketing — it is the result of the freeze-drying process combined with oxygen-free packaging. Independent testing has confirmed that Mountain House meals remain safe and palatable well beyond the guaranteed period.
